66 Export Drive forms part of an Industrial Estate known as the Darwin Business Park (DBP). DBP is a developed dedicated Industrial precinct designed for heavy transport access and zoned appropriately for Industrial use.
DBP is close to the East Arm container Wharf, Berrimah Rail and Freight Terminal. It is near to the Marine Industry Park where the $100 million new ship lift, barge ramp and common user facility are under construction as well as close to Truck Central which is a facility dedicated to vehicle inspection, road train assembly and refueling for road transport.
The size of East Arm is approximately 11.8 square kilometres. The population of East Arm in 2016 was 13 people. By 2021 the population was 15 showing a population growth of 15.4%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in East Arm is 40-49 years. Households in East Arm are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in East Arm work in a managers occupation.In 2021, 0.00% of the homes in East Arm were owner-occupied compared with 0.00% in 2016.
